I think its just bulky. Think about it:
Is it smaller than a pipe and a lighter? No.
Is it easier to hide than a pipe? No.
Is it easier to use than a pipe and a lighter? I guess that can be debated, but I would say, No.
Is it less conspicuous than a pipe? Definitely not.
And the biggest one, that has already been addressed.........
Is it cost effective? Nope.
You can get a nice bubbler or bong for that price, yeah it will be china glass, but its just that, glass.
Just basic marketing, sorry.
